The MIDI Innovation awards give a platform for MIDI innovation and rewards products, prototypes, installations or concepts that are thought-provoking and inspire new, creative use cases.
On Saturday, May 28, Host LJ Rich was joined by an international panel of judges and the finalists from the 2022 MIDI Innovations Awards to explore the latest in MIDI Innovation at the MIDI Innovation 2022 Awards Show.
World-renowned musician and BBC TV broadcaster LJ Rich presents on the International Technology show BBC Click, read Music at Oxford and is a NASA Datanaut, so she’s met astronauts, tech visionaries and artists from Stevie Wonder to Steve Wozniak. LJ’s also performed musically at The United Nations in Geneva, Harvard University in Boston, at TEDxTokyo numerous live and virtual engagements. Her past work at QVC and other shopping channels gives her a unique insight into the future of consumers behaviour. LJ’s been interviewed by the New York Times and other international publications about her synesthesia, a neurological condition which mixes her senses together and inspires many compositions and installations.

The Music Hackspace’s mission is to become the largest platform for learning music technologies. We are passionate about helping musicians develop their programming skills, host workshops led by world experts and enable the community to share knowledge and practices.
Founded in 1901, NAMM (National Association of Music Merchants) is the not-for-profit association with a mission to strengthen the $17 billion music products industry and promote the pleasures and benefits of making music.
The MIDI Association is the non-profit community for both the companies who develop new MIDI specifications and products and the people that create music and art with MIDI. The MIDI.org website is the central repository of information about anything related to MIDI technology, from classic legacy gear to the next- gen MIDI protocols coming soon.
